Canada clay oven

Clay ovens, also known as earth ovens, have been used for cooking food for centuries in various cultures around the world, including in Canada. These ovens are made by digging a hole in the ground, lining it with clay or mud, and then building a fire inside to heat the oven.
In Canada, clay ovens are often used in outdoor settings such as backyards, parks, and campsites. They are popular for cooking pizza, bread, and other baked goods, as well as for roasting meats and vegetables. The oven’s design allows for even cooking and a unique smoky flavor that is difficult to achieve with other cooking methods.
Building a clay oven requires some skill and effort, as it involves digging a hole, mixing clay, and shaping it into the desired oven shape. However, there are many resources available online for those interested in building their own clay oven.
Overall, clay ovens in Canada provide a fun and unique way to cook food outdoors, and are enjoyed by many people for their delicious results.
